What is a Link Shortener?

A link shortener is a web-based tool or service that converts long URLs into shorter, more manageable links. These shortened links typically redirect users to the original URL when clicked. Benefits of Using a Link Shortener

1. Improved Aesthetics & Readability

Long URLs with multiple parameters can look messy and unprofessional. Shortened links are cleaner and easier to share, especially on platforms with character limits like Twitter.

2. Enhanced Click-Through Rates (CTR)

Studies show that users are more likely to click on shorter, branded links compared to long, complex URLs. A well-crafted short link can increase engagement and drive more traffic.

3. Link Tracking & Analytics

Most link shorteners provide tracking tools that allow users to monitor link performance, including click rates, geographic locations, and referral sources. These insights help in optimizing marketing strategies.

4. Custom Branding

Some link shorteners allow businesses to create branded short URLs (e.g., yourbrand.link/sale) instead of generic links. This boosts credibility and trust among users.

5. Better User Experience

A shortened link makes it easier for users to access a webpage without copying and pasting long URLs, reducing friction and improving the browsing experience.

6. Higher Shareability

Shortened links are more suitable for sharing on social media, emails, and SMS campaigns. They take up less space and look more appealing to users.

How to Use a Link Shortener Effectively

1. Choose a Reliable Link Shortener

Opt for reputable services like Bitly, Rebrandly, TinyURL, or YRS.LI. If you require custom branding, consider premium options.

2. Use Custom Short Links

Custom-branded short links are more recognizable and trustworthy than generic ones, which can sometimes appear spammy.

3. Monitor Performance

Leverage analytics to track your links’ effectiveness. Adjust your marketing strategies based on insights like click trends and user demographics.

4. Avoid Spammy Links

Some shortened links may be flagged as spam, especially if they redirect to suspicious sites. Always ensure your links are used ethically and lead to credible content.

5. Optimize for SEO

While shortened links don’t directly impact SEO, they can enhance user engagement, which indirectly benefits search rankings. When possible, use descriptive slugs for better context.
